Welcome to the heating guide for Nurenmerenmong, situated in postcode 2649. Utilising data from the nearest weather station (TUMBARUMBA POST OFFICE) at an elevation of 645 metres above sea level, which started operating in 1885 with the latest data recorded in 2023, we can analyse the temperature trends crucial for your home's heating needs.

In this region, winters have recorded temperatures as low as -9.4 degrees C, highlighting the necessity for energy-efficient heating systems. During these colder months (June, Juily and August), we see an average minimum temperature of 0.3 degreees celcius, while the average humidity level at 9 am is around 87.7% and 65.7% at 3 pm for this period. Demographics

Based on the Australian Bureau of Statistics 2021 Census, postcode 2649, which includes Nurenmerenmong, has a total 12 homes. This community features a diverse array of housing types: 10 are houses, each with an average of 2.6 residents per dwelling. With the community's varied income levels, where the median weekly household income is 1375 and with 67% homes mortgaged or rented, investing in energy-efficient heating options is even more essential to help reduce running costs and increase long-term financial savings for homeowners or renters.

When considering the demographics of Nurenmerenmong and 2649 more broadly, we discover there are 3 families with children. At the same time, 10% of the 30 population are over 65 years old, while 3 people also live with long-term health conditions.
